Wizkid advises followers to "work smart," and avoid "hustling like a fool" after Davido's cryptocurrency crash, sparking reactions and discussions about financial prudence on social media.

Renowned Nigerian singer Wizkid has sparked a wave of reactions on social media after sharing a cryptic piece of advice, urging his followers to "work smart" and avoid "hustling like a fool." The singer's words came just hours after his colleague Davido ventured into the cryptocurrency realm with the launch of his digital coin, which subsequently crashed.

Wizkid took to Twitter to share his thoughts, writing: "Work smart make u no go Dey hustle like fool ❤️ 🦅." While the message was concise, it resonated with many netizens who interpreted it as a veiled reference to Davido's cryptocurrency debacle.

The tweet garnered a flood of reactions, with some users concurring with Wizkid's sentiment and cautioning against impulsive investments in volatile markets. One user commented, implying that reckless investments can lead to financial ruin.

Others speculated about Wizkid's true intentions behind the tweet, suggesting that the singer was fully aware of the situation surrounding Davido's cryptocurrency launch.

The discourse also took a humorous turn, with users questioning the implications of Wizkid's advice, wondering if the singer was implying that seeking quick money equates to being a "fool."

While Wizkid's tweet may have been open to interpretation, it undoubtedly struck a chord with many, reigniting discussions about financial prudence and cautioning against blindly following trends without proper due diligence.
